Output 25763854931acb2b0de2195d13db7104b81fd51d3ffed67a00ac770a80004b7e:1

value
1343016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9387b9a3cb7e5d52b8fce2d908cf63929c185e86 OP_EQUALVERIFY OP_CHECKSIG
address
1ET4vYoARTj65WHG6hYnxaN3LP5yqeXnMT
transaction
25763854931acb2b0de2195d13db7104b81fd51d3ffed67a00ac770a80004b7e
confirmations
645175
spent
true